About Modu-Laser LLC
Modu-Laser produces a variety of quality air-cooled argon lasers for use in a diverse range of applications including Spectroscopy, Flow Cytometery, Research, and Education. In addition, Modu-Laser's team of engineering professionals can work with you to provide customized solutions to meet your unique OEM requirements. Ask us about our Argon Gas Lasers.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Salt Lake City?

Understanding the cost of living near Salt Lake City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Modu-Laser LLC.
Salt Lake City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.3 (4.3% more expensive than US average; 2.8% more than UT average). State capital, growing tech scene, housing costs above US avg. UTA bus/TRAX/FrontRunner. When planning your budget based on a salary from Modu-Laser LLC,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Modu-Laser LLC sal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$180 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$85 (UT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,675 - $4,135+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
